Well, 'Fullmetal Alchemist: Brotherhood' is an excellent anime adventure story. The Elric brothers, Edward and Alphonse, embark on a journey to find the Philosopher's Stone in order to regain their bodies. It's filled with action, moral dilemmas, and great character development. 'Hunter x Hunter' is also a good choice. Gon Freecss leaves his home to become a Hunter like his father and experiences all kinds of challenges and adventures in the Hunter world.
